THE DIFFERENCES

1. CHARGING

We manufacture solar lighting systems without diminishing the overall light intensity. All competing manufacturers implement motion sensors to acquire a five day back-up. When the sensor detects a moving object from a specific distance, the lighting system starts working with 100% of its nominal power, while otherwise it works with only 20% to 40%, based on its defined parameters. It is also possible to use programmable charge controllers. By this method, and based on duration of a night (8 hours in summer and 12 to 14 hours in winter, subject to the geolocation), light intensity is programmed to be 100% for the first four hours, 40% to 50% for the following four hours and 10% to 20% for the rest of the night, until sunrise. However, based on the standards of lighting systems, in particular of freeways and highways, the implementation of these systems is prohibited, as the dimming causes fatigue of the driver and provokes accidents.

2. SUPER POWER

In other systems, once the light hits the panels, the voltage of the panel starts to increase, and once the voltage reaches 12V, the battery starts to charge. We are using a controller to start charging the battery in overcast weather conditions. The controller charges the battery with as little as 6V, which provides 30% to 45% of the overall energy consumption. This also increases the battery lifetime by as much as three times. If the panel charging period in other systems is around six hours of useful output, ours is as much as 50% more, translating to nine hours. This clearly means that with inclement weather conditions prevailing, our system charges batteries 30% to 45% more as compared to the competition, whereas conventional systems are not charging during these weather conditions, which ultimately yields an increased back-up capacity.

4. FEEDING ENERGY

We have designed a separate direct feed for every LED. This means that if one LED is burnt, only that one LED will be out of service, which will ultimately not impact the output of the other LEDs. This is clearly not the case with all of the other systems, where one burnt LED causes a series of other LEDs to go out of service, leading to an increase of the overall voltage and current of the system that is fed to the other LEDs, hence reducing their overall lifespan.

OUR SOLUTIONS FOR INSTALLATION OF SOLAR LIGHTING SYSTEMS IN DESERT AREAS:

aIncreasing the tilt angle of the solar panels during installation without decreasing the solar light absorption. This ceases the accumulation of dust or mud on the surface of the panels.

bUsing self-cleaning and anti-soiling Nano coating on the panels, which decreases the friction on the surface of panel, hence preventing the accumulation of dust, mud and rain on the surface of panels.
